Contract Description

The contractor shall provide all labor and supervision required to maintain grass, remove weeds, seeding, and cutting of the lawn, edging and blowing the grass from the sidewalks/road, fertilization of the lawn twice per year, removal of fallen leaves, removal of dead trees/shrubs/limbs/debris from the grounds. Lawn cutting and edging will occur weekly, on a schedule agreed by both parties. Hedge/ tree trimming will occur based on their natural growth habits. Compensation for skipping cutting and edging (due to weather, slow growth, etc.) will be applied to other ground projects to be determined by the facility.
